Browse Source

:fire: Supprime ecran de victoire

DricomDragon 10 tháng trước cách đây
mục cha
commit
bc379119f6

+ 2 - 1
godot/composants/interface/gagne/gagne.tscn

@@ -1,4 +1,4 @@
-[gd_scene format=3 uid="uid://byxtc8f6n5o3"]
+[gd_scene format=3 uid="uid://b8tr5lj54m8j5"]
 
 [node name="Gagne" type="Control"]
 layout_mode = 3
@@ -25,6 +25,7 @@ theme_override_font_sizes/font_size = 80
 text = "Bravo !"
 
 [node name="CommandeRetour" type="Label" parent="."]
+layout_mode = 0
 offset_left = 150.0
 offset_top = 336.0
 offset_right = 330.0

+ 9 - 8
godot/composants/objets/brique/conteneur_briques.gd

@@ -2,9 +2,10 @@ class_name ConteneurDeBriques
 extends Node2D
 
 
-signal plus_de_briques
+## C'est la victoire !
+#signal plus_de_briques
 
-@onready var nombre_enfants: int = get_children().size()
+#@onready var nombre_enfants: int = get_children().size()
 
 
 func _ready() -> void:
@@ -12,13 +13,13 @@ func _ready() -> void:
 		assert(node is Brique or node is ConteneurDeBriques, "Ne peut contenir que des briques")
 		if node is Brique:
 			var brique: Brique = node as Brique
-			brique.eclatee.connect(_quand_enfant_detruit)
+			#brique.eclatee.connect(_quand_enfant_detruit)
 		elif node is ConteneurDeBriques:
 			var contenant: ConteneurDeBriques = node as ConteneurDeBriques
-			contenant.plus_de_briques.connect(_quand_enfant_detruit)
+			#contenant.plus_de_briques.connect(_quand_enfant_detruit)
 
 
-func _quand_enfant_detruit() -> void:
-	nombre_enfants -= 1
-	if nombre_enfants <= 0:
-		plus_de_briques.emit()
+#func _quand_enfant_detruit() -> void:
+#	nombre_enfants -= 1
+	#if nombre_enfants <= 0:
+		#plus_de_briques.emit()

+ 1 - 9
godot/exec/niveaux/blob_facile.tscn

@@ -1,4 +1,4 @@
-[gd_scene load_steps=11 format=3 uid="uid://b11cxtgl8mwvm"]
+[gd_scene load_steps=10 format=3 uid="uid://b11cxtgl8mwvm"]
 
 [ext_resource type="Texture2D" uid="uid://3qk2oqmb0fyl" path="res://exec/niveaux/fonds/ground22.png" id="1_0yxll"]
 [ext_resource type="PackedScene" uid="uid://cpo1b44exbbyf" path="res://composants/objets/raquette/raquette.tscn" id="1_acy65"]
@@ -7,7 +7,6 @@
 [ext_resource type="PackedScene" uid="uid://brd8yid3l7wgm" path="res://composants/objets/brique/brique.tscn" id="4_nhi56"]
 [ext_resource type="PackedScene" uid="uid://b28d5a4be36qa" path="res://composants/objets/arene/arene.tscn" id="5_jfp2p"]
 [ext_resource type="PackedScene" uid="uid://mj0r0qodppdk" path="res://composants/interface/perdu/perdu.tscn" id="6_vwded"]
-[ext_resource type="PackedScene" uid="uid://byxtc8f6n5o3" path="res://composants/interface/gagne/gagne.tscn" id="7_3ob7h"]
 [ext_resource type="PackedScene" uid="uid://ds3j5rjhys4xf" path="res://composants/interface/stock/stock.tscn" id="8_jjbb6"]
 [ext_resource type="AudioStream" uid="uid://1p4lhi3rprps" path="res://ressources/musiques/atelier_godot_level_main_loop.ogg" id="10_40ea0"]
 
@@ -97,10 +96,6 @@ offset_bottom = 400.0
 visible = false
 layout_mode = 2
 
-[node name="Gagne" parent="Message" instance=ExtResource("7_3ob7h")]
-visible = false
-layout_mode = 2
-
 [node name="Stock" parent="." instance=ExtResource("8_jjbb6")]
 offset_bottom = 420.0
 
@@ -113,7 +108,4 @@ bus = &"Musique"
 [connection signal="nb_balles_change" from="Lanceur" to="Stock" method="_quand_nombre_balles_change"]
 [connection signal="partie_perdue" from="Lanceur" to="Message" method="show"]
 [connection signal="partie_perdue" from="Lanceur" to="Message/Perdu" method="show"]
-[connection signal="plus_de_briques" from="Briques" to="Lanceur" method="queue_free"]
-[connection signal="plus_de_briques" from="Briques" to="Message" method="show"]
-[connection signal="plus_de_briques" from="Briques" to="Message/Gagne" method="show"]
 [connection signal="balle_detruite" from="Arene" to="Lanceur" method="_quand_balle_detruite"]

+ 1 - 9
godot/exec/niveaux/carre_simple.tscn

@@ -1,4 +1,4 @@
-[gd_scene load_steps=11 format=3 uid="uid://cyyb8weydthjc"]
+[gd_scene load_steps=10 format=3 uid="uid://cyyb8weydthjc"]
 
 [ext_resource type="PackedScene" uid="uid://cpo1b44exbbyf" path="res://composants/objets/raquette/raquette.tscn" id="1_dbta1"]
 [ext_resource type="Texture2D" uid="uid://byid0wqsvr6xg" path="res://exec/niveaux/fonds/ground01.png" id="1_hdm68"]
@@ -7,7 +7,6 @@
 [ext_resource type="Script" path="res://composants/objets/brique/conteneur_briques.gd" id="3_dsde7"]
 [ext_resource type="PackedScene" uid="uid://b28d5a4be36qa" path="res://composants/objets/arene/arene.tscn" id="4_imfht"]
 [ext_resource type="PackedScene" uid="uid://mj0r0qodppdk" path="res://composants/interface/perdu/perdu.tscn" id="5_4gti5"]
-[ext_resource type="PackedScene" uid="uid://byxtc8f6n5o3" path="res://composants/interface/gagne/gagne.tscn" id="7_16b2w"]
 [ext_resource type="PackedScene" uid="uid://ds3j5rjhys4xf" path="res://composants/interface/stock/stock.tscn" id="8_f28fe"]
 [ext_resource type="AudioStream" uid="uid://1p4lhi3rprps" path="res://ressources/musiques/atelier_godot_level_main_loop.ogg" id="10_4so2q"]
 
@@ -165,10 +164,6 @@ offset_bottom = 400.0
 visible = false
 layout_mode = 2
 
-[node name="Gagne" parent="Message" instance=ExtResource("7_16b2w")]
-visible = false
-layout_mode = 2
-
 [node name="Stock" parent="." instance=ExtResource("8_f28fe")]
 offset_bottom = 420.0
 
@@ -181,7 +176,4 @@ bus = &"Musique"
 [connection signal="nb_balles_change" from="Lanceur" to="Stock" method="_quand_nombre_balles_change"]
 [connection signal="partie_perdue" from="Lanceur" to="Message" method="show"]
 [connection signal="partie_perdue" from="Lanceur" to="Message/Perdu" method="show"]
-[connection signal="plus_de_briques" from="Briques" to="Lanceur" method="queue_free"]
-[connection signal="plus_de_briques" from="Briques" to="Message" method="show"]
-[connection signal="plus_de_briques" from="Briques" to="Message/Gagne" method="show"]
 [connection signal="balle_detruite" from="Arene" to="Lanceur" method="_quand_balle_detruite"]

+ 1 - 9
godot/exec/niveaux/jdll2024.tscn

@@ -1,4 +1,4 @@
-[gd_scene load_steps=11 format=3 uid="uid://dh15j87pa6rul"]
+[gd_scene load_steps=10 format=3 uid="uid://dh15j87pa6rul"]
 
 [ext_resource type="PackedScene" uid="uid://cpo1b44exbbyf" path="res://composants/objets/raquette/raquette.tscn" id="1_2omxn"]
 [ext_resource type="Texture2D" uid="uid://byivppnn85c4n" path="res://exec/niveaux/fonds/jdll2024gradient.svg" id="1_y1m81"]
@@ -7,7 +7,6 @@
 [ext_resource type="PackedScene" uid="uid://brd8yid3l7wgm" path="res://composants/objets/brique/brique.tscn" id="4_upd8n"]
 [ext_resource type="PackedScene" uid="uid://b28d5a4be36qa" path="res://composants/objets/arene/arene.tscn" id="5_j3mb3"]
 [ext_resource type="PackedScene" uid="uid://mj0r0qodppdk" path="res://composants/interface/perdu/perdu.tscn" id="6_rsl83"]
-[ext_resource type="PackedScene" uid="uid://byxtc8f6n5o3" path="res://composants/interface/gagne/gagne.tscn" id="7_dssks"]
 [ext_resource type="PackedScene" uid="uid://ds3j5rjhys4xf" path="res://composants/interface/stock/stock.tscn" id="8_ej7nx"]
 [ext_resource type="AudioStream" uid="uid://1p4lhi3rprps" path="res://ressources/musiques/atelier_godot_level_main_loop.ogg" id="10_mh31g"]
 
@@ -488,10 +487,6 @@ offset_bottom = 400.0
 visible = false
 layout_mode = 2
 
-[node name="Gagne" parent="Message" instance=ExtResource("7_dssks")]
-visible = false
-layout_mode = 2
-
 [node name="Stock" parent="." instance=ExtResource("8_ej7nx")]
 offset_bottom = 420.0
 
@@ -504,7 +499,4 @@ bus = &"Musique"
 [connection signal="nb_balles_change" from="Lanceur" to="Stock" method="_quand_nombre_balles_change"]
 [connection signal="partie_perdue" from="Lanceur" to="Message" method="show"]
 [connection signal="partie_perdue" from="Lanceur" to="Message/Perdu" method="show"]
-[connection signal="plus_de_briques" from="Briques" to="Lanceur" method="queue_free"]
-[connection signal="plus_de_briques" from="Briques" to="Message" method="show"]
-[connection signal="plus_de_briques" from="Briques" to="Message/Gagne" method="show"]
 [connection signal="balle_detruite" from="Arene" to="Lanceur" method="_quand_balle_detruite"]

+ 1 - 9
godot/exec/niveaux/mini_centre.tscn

@@ -1,4 +1,4 @@
-[gd_scene load_steps=11 format=3 uid="uid://18mfasfcx418"]
+[gd_scene load_steps=10 format=3 uid="uid://18mfasfcx418"]
 
 [ext_resource type="Texture2D" uid="uid://bt57uww7im6yf" path="res://exec/niveaux/fonds/ground05.png" id="1_16k1s"]
 [ext_resource type="PackedScene" uid="uid://cpo1b44exbbyf" path="res://composants/objets/raquette/raquette.tscn" id="1_ajuqp"]
@@ -7,7 +7,6 @@
 [ext_resource type="PackedScene" uid="uid://brd8yid3l7wgm" path="res://composants/objets/brique/brique.tscn" id="4_wc6tb"]
 [ext_resource type="PackedScene" uid="uid://b28d5a4be36qa" path="res://composants/objets/arene/arene.tscn" id="5_lb6y8"]
 [ext_resource type="PackedScene" uid="uid://mj0r0qodppdk" path="res://composants/interface/perdu/perdu.tscn" id="6_plfv0"]
-[ext_resource type="PackedScene" uid="uid://byxtc8f6n5o3" path="res://composants/interface/gagne/gagne.tscn" id="7_8rmw2"]
 [ext_resource type="PackedScene" uid="uid://ds3j5rjhys4xf" path="res://composants/interface/stock/stock.tscn" id="8_8ltoc"]
 [ext_resource type="AudioStream" uid="uid://1p4lhi3rprps" path="res://ressources/musiques/atelier_godot_level_main_loop.ogg" id="10_ujhky"]
 
@@ -44,10 +43,6 @@ offset_bottom = 400.0
 visible = false
 layout_mode = 2
 
-[node name="Gagne" parent="Message" instance=ExtResource("7_8rmw2")]
-visible = false
-layout_mode = 2
-
 [node name="Stock" parent="." instance=ExtResource("8_8ltoc")]
 offset_bottom = 420.0
 
@@ -60,7 +55,4 @@ bus = &"Musique"
 [connection signal="nb_balles_change" from="Lanceur" to="Stock" method="_quand_nombre_balles_change"]
 [connection signal="partie_perdue" from="Lanceur" to="Message" method="show"]
 [connection signal="partie_perdue" from="Lanceur" to="Message/Perdu" method="show"]
-[connection signal="plus_de_briques" from="Briques" to="Lanceur" method="queue_free"]
-[connection signal="plus_de_briques" from="Briques" to="Message" method="show"]
-[connection signal="plus_de_briques" from="Briques" to="Message/Gagne" method="show"]
 [connection signal="balle_detruite" from="Arene" to="Lanceur" method="_quand_balle_detruite"]